81 Ashley Brush - Rising from the Ashes and Heading to the Mountains

Ashley Brush was born and raised in a strict, religious upbringing and, by her early 20s, she was married, with a young son, and was also a stepmother to two other children.
At this time, because she was playing by a strict set of rules, she says she had no idea who she really was because she was so young and never gave herself an opportunity to find out.
Resentment and depression were the norms, which led to drugs and binge eating to numb the pain.
Just a couple of years ago, Ashley went back to one joy she had as a child/teenager — running. She quietly started running again and, magically, a portal opened to happiness, joy, self-confidence, and profound freedom.
THIS is what she was meant to do…and today she’s doing it. Ashley is a coach, trainer, and ultra-endurance athlete. She runs redjasperrunning.com and the Rising Runners group in Bend, OR. She's also a coach for Team RunRun, working with runners of all levels.
By “pouring love all over herself,” she has started to discover the woman she was meant to be.
